Lead and manage a team of unit process engineers covering all types of automotive high-power molded modules in Regensburg backend production.

As Senior Manager, I am responsible for a team of process engineers. Our daily focus is on manufacturing high-power modules for electromobility, thus actively contributing to efforts aimed at making life greener. One result of my work, for example, is the combination of high-performance molding module 1 with module 2, which enables electromobility.

I am part of the unit process engineering team at the Regensburg backend production line. This team has achieved an important milestone in contributing to the hybridization of around 1.75 million cars worldwide – and this journey continues. I was also part of the talent management program (CLIMB) at Regensburg. In addition, I am qualified as a “Thinking Six Sigma + Lean Green Belt Trainer” and achieved the problem solving accreditation of “Black Belt Thinking Six Sigma + Lean”.
